Jerry 5TJ Posted October 1, 2018 Report Posted October 1, 2018 Merrja You wrote “electric AI” but we all assume you mean Electronic with no moving parts. I certainly agree that you don’t want another spinning mechanical gyro. If you’re really seeking only an AI a used RCA2600-3 is good. Examples have been offered on the used market for around $1500. But for “only” twice as much you can get a new G5 with lots more capabilities. Quote

RobertGary1 Posted October 1, 2018 Report Posted October 1, 2018 FYI the g5 requires a gps source for stc certification. It’s used to correct drift internally. -Robert 1 Quote
merrja Posted October 1, 2018 Author Report Posted October 1, 2018 I also purchased the Garmin Wass Antenna, so I guess the garmin transponder will be my next purchase for the ADSB compliance Quote
MIm20c Posted October 1, 2018 Report Posted October 1, 2018 3 minutes ago, merrja said: I also purchased the Garmin Wass Antenna, so I guess the garmin transponder will be my next purchase for the ADSB compliance Leave the antenna cable long enough to reach the future adsb transponder. Later on the g5 can use the position source from the transponder and you won’t need another waas speed brake on the top of your plane. 1 Quote
ArtVandelay Posted October 1, 2018 Report Posted October 1, 2018 FYI the g5 requires a gps source for stc certification. It’s used to correct drift internally. -Robert It has an internal one, antenna maybe required, don’t know if stc allows it. Quote
RobertGary1 Posted October 2, 2018 Report Posted October 2, 2018 3 hours ago, teejayevans said: It has an internal one, antenna maybe required, don’t know if stc allows it. External antenna is required unless you have a gps source for jt. So if you don’t you need to wire up an antenna -Robert Quote
jetdriven Posted October 2, 2018 Report Posted October 2, 2018 Run 2 cables to the ceiling so when you get a GPS later you don’t have to pull all the interior out to do it again Quote
RobertGary1 Posted October 2, 2018 Report Posted October 2, 2018 5 hours ago, jetdriven said: Run 2 cables to the ceiling so when you get a GPS later you don’t have to pull all the interior out to do it again You only need one. If you wire an antenna for the g5 today if you get a gps later you can unplug it from the g5 and plug it into the gps. Then run a data line from the gps to the g5. -Robert 1 Quote
